Long-term unemployment still hinders hiring
Some HR managers are being more open to the long-term unemployed, but concerns remain about a skills gap for such workers, experts say. "There is still a negative stigma toward people who have been unemployed for a while. We see companies that have job postings that explicitly say they'll only accept resumes of people who are currently employed," says Mike Barefoot of Red Zone Resources.
